I’m thrilled to welcome my special guest, Dr. Heidi Kohltfarber, onto the show to talk all about dental radiology and what radiology can do for your dental practice.

Dr. Heidi Kohltfarber is a dental radiologist and associate professor in the Department of Radiologic Imaging at Loma Linda University School of Dentistry. She’s also an adjunct professor in the Department of Diagnostic Sciences at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. Dr. Kohltfarber is very passionate about 3D imaging with a particular focus on how it applies to oral health care.

In 2013, Heidi founded “Dental Radiology Diagnostics” where she currently resides and works as both the owner and managing oral and maxillofacial radiologist.
